当前位置: 代码迷 >> QT开发 >> DOM方式写XML文件解决思路
  详细解决方案

DOM方式写XML文件解决思路

热度:75   发布时间:2016-04-25 04:47:43.0
DOM方式写XML文件
在写xml文件时,给某个元素element通过setAttributeNode加几个属性,如id、sex、name
完成后,打开文件看到,这几个属性是按字母顺序排列的:id="" name="" sex=""
怎么设置其排序,我想自己设定这几个属性的顺序?

------解决方案--------------------
你可以直接用写文件的方式写个报文,想怎么写就怎么写。。
------解决方案--------------------
好巧我也是这几天在用DOM来写XML,对于attribute的值,如楼上所说可以用文件读写,想怎么写就怎么写,但是这样的弊端在于什么都要自己写,很不便捷.
我觉得如果仅仅是达到目的,可以使用一些比较恶心的方法,比如在你的属性的name前面添加上特殊的字符.然后就可以按照这些特殊字符的顺序来任意设定你所需要的attribute的顺序了
  相关解决方案